Lake Mead Reptile Communities Forty-one species of reptiles and 12 species of amphibians have been recorded at Lake Mead NRA. At full pool, Lake Mead is the largest reservoir in the United States by volume and is second only to Lake Powell in surface area (Paulson and Baker 1983).
